Banas River
River in Rajasthan, India
Banas River ▸ Facts ▸ Comments ▸ News ▸ Videos

The Banas is a river which lies entirely within the state of Rajasthan in western India. It is a tributary of the Chambal River, itself a tributary of the Yamuna, which in turn merges into the Ganga. The Banas is approximately 512 kilometres in length.
